Summary
Patrice Bellot is a seasoned computer science professor and research leader based in Marseille, specializing in text mining, information retrieval and NLP, with over a decade of senior academic and scientific-management experience. He serves as Directeur adjoint du LIS and professor at Aix-Marseille Université, while also acting as Délégué scientifique for CNRS in areas including open science and textual data mining. He founded and led influential research groups and labs (DIMAG, OpenEdition Lab) that bridge digital humanities, digital libraries and applied IR research, and he teaches courses from software testing to data mining at Polytech Marseille. His career combines deep academic credentials (PhD and HDR) with sustained industry partnerships (Sinequa, Syllabs, Advestigo), reflecting an applied focus on moving research into production. Colleagues know him for blending rigorous methodological work in NLP with institutional leadership that advances open scientific infrastructures.
